实验一MATLAB 程序入门和基础应用 一、实验名称 MATLAB 程序入门和基础应用 二、实验目的 1
学习 Matlab 软件的基本使用方法; 2
了解 Matlab 的数值计算,符号运算,可视化功能; 3
Matlab 程序设计入门 四、实验设备 计算机 MATLAB 软件 六、实验内容及具体步骤 1、打开 MATLAB 的系统界面,对其功能做一个大致了解; 2、学习变量的描述方法,掌握几个固定变量: I,j,pi,inf 的使用
注意,变量描述以字母开头,可以由字母、数字和下划线混合组成,区分字母大,小写字符长度不超过 31 个
3、学习数值,矩阵,运算符,向量的矩阵运算,数组运算的描述方法
(1)用一个简单命令求解线性系统 3x 1+ x 2 - x 3 =3
6 x 1+2x 2+4x 3 = 2
1 -x 1+4x 2+5x 3 = -1
4 A=[3 1 -1;1 2 4;-1 4 5];b=[3
4]; x =A\b 结果:x = 1
4818 -0
4606 0
3848 (2)用简短命令计算并绘制在 0x 6 范围内的 sin(2x )、sinx 2、sin2x
x =linspace(0,6) y 1=sin(2*x ),y 2=sin(x
^2),y 3=(sin(x ))
^2; plot(x ,y 1,x , y 2,x , y 3) 4、Matlab 符号运算功能 (1)符号运算的过程 在符号运算的整个过程中,所有的运算均是以符号进行的,即使以数字形式出现的量也是字符量
做一个对 sin(x /2)求导的过程
在命令窗口中输入如下符号表达式按回车: f='sin(x /2)'; dfdx =diff(f) 显示结果如下: dfdx = 1/2*cos(1/2*x ) 整个求导的过程都是